Islamabad: The Supreme Court on Thursday annoyed over noncompliance of its orders of bringing police officer Hussain Asghar back into Haj corruption case investigation.
A three-judge bench of the apex court headed by Chief Justice Iftikhar Muhammad Chaudhry sought clarification from establishment division and interior secretary.
The CJ remarked the court had previously ordered reappointment of Mr Asghar as investigation officer in the case but the orders were not implemented.
The CJ asked Deputy Attorney Gen Shafique Chandio that the court’s orders in Balochistan cas regarding police officeres had been implemented but it was not done in Haj corruption case.
The DAG failed to satisfy the court.
It is to mention here that Hussain Asgahr was appointed as IG Gilgit-Baltistan when he had started exposing bigwigs for their corruption in Haj affairs.
